2012 (10) TMI 362 - AT - Income TaxExemption u/S 80IB(10) - date of completion of project - Held that:- In section 80IB(10) it has been made emphatically clear that if the housing project is approved before 1st April, 2004 and is completed before 31.3.2008, the assessee would be entitled for deduction under section 80IB(10) and through its Explanation (i) it has been made clear that the date of completion of construction of housing project shall be taken to be date on which completion certificate in respect of such housing project is issued by the local authority. Therefore, there is no iota of doubt in the interpretation of Explanation below section 80IB(10) and according to the said Explanation, the date of completion of the project in the instant case shall be taken to be the date of issuance of completion certificate by the local authority i.e. 23.10.2009. Since the housing project was completed after 31.3.2008, the assessee has not fulfilled the second requisite condition for claiming deduction under section 80IB(10) and therefore the assessee is not entitled for deduction under section 80IB(10). Instruction No. 4 of 2009 dated 30.6.2009 of the Board, through which it has been clarified by the Board that deduction under section 80IB(10) can be claimed on year-to-year basis where the assessee is showing profit from partial completion of the project in every year. It was also further clarified that in case it is late found that the condition of completing the project within the specified time limit of four years, as stated in section 80IB(10) has not been satisfied, deduction granted to the assessee under section 80IB(10)in earlier years should be withdrawn - Thus the Revenue is at liberty to take action with respect to the earlier years as provided in the law - against assessee.
